Gibo Teodoro pays Sara Duterte a visit, gets vaccinated vs. COVID-19 in Davao City


Former Defense Secretary Gilberto "Gibo" Teodoro Jr., met Davao City Mayor Sara Duterte on Wednesday amid reports that the daughter of President Rodrigo Duterte will run for president in Eleksyon 2022.

Former Camarines Sur Representative Rolando "Nonoy" Andaya Jr. posted photos of their visit to Sara in Davao City on his official Facebook page.

The pictures also showed Teodoro getting vaccinated in Duterte's hometown.

Andaya told reporters that Teodoro went through the necessary procedures before he got vaccinated. He said Teodoro was under the A3 category.

"Dumaan naman siya sa of course the usual na proseso ng pagdetermina ng pangangailangan nang mag-vaccinate siya at he’s really A3. He’s really up for vaccination na," Andaya said.

In another post, Andaya took a selfie on the plane with Teodoro in the background.

He captioned it with, "On my way with my Vice President to meet my President. Done deal folks."

Asked to elaborate on what he meant was the "done deal," Andaya said he had dreamed of Sara and Teodoro leading the country.

"Tingin ko done deal para sa bansa na rin ‘to e. Konti na lang, siguro oras na lang ang binibilang na magiging totoo talaga na hindi lang panaginip na tandem  namin ‘to, magiging tandem ‘to ng buong bansa," Andaya said.

Albay Representative Joey Salceda earlier said there was no doubt in his mind that Sara would run for president.

He said believed Sara would run unopposed in the coming polls.

Sara, for her part, remained mum on whether she would run for presidency. —NB, GMA News
